Wood window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ows with new, high-quality wooden frames. This process typically includes removing the old windows, preparing the opening for the new units, and carefully installing the wooden frames to ensure a proper fit. Skilled contractors may also finish the wood with protective coatings or paint to enhance durability and appearance. Proper installation is essential to ensure the windows operate smoothly, provide proper insulation, and contribute to the overall aesthetic of the property.
These services help address common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Over time, wooden windows can become warped, rotted, or damaged by moisture, leading to leaks and reduced efficiency. Replacing old or damaged wood windows with new installations can improve energy efficiency, reduce noise infiltration, and prevent further deterioration. This makes wood window installation a practical solution for homeowners seeking to enhance comfort and maintain the integrity of their property.

Smaller Repairs - Minor wood window repairs, such as replacing rotted sashes or fixing broken panes, typ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. These projects are common and usually fall within the middle of the price range. Local contractors often handle these efficiently and affordably.
Full Window Replacement - Replacing an entire wood window with a new, energy-efficient model generally ranges from $1,200 to $3,000 per window. Larger, more complex projects can reach $4,000 or more, though many jobs stay within the mid-range. Many local pros can provide options suited to different budgets.
Custom or Historic Window Restoration - Restoring or replicating historic wood windows can cost between $2,500 and $6,000 per window, depending on size and detail. These projects are less common and often involve specialized craftsmanship, which influences the higher end of the range. Local service providers with experience in historic preservation are typically engaged for these jobs.
Multiple Window Projects - Installing or replacing several wood windows at once usually results in a total cost of $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the number and complexity of windows. Many projects fall into the middle of this range, with larger or more elaborate installations reaching higher totals. Local contractors can often offer volume discounts for multi-window jobs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ing wood windows for installation? Wood windows offer natural insulation, classic aesthetic appeal, and can enhance the overall look of a home in Warner Robins, GA and nearby areas.
How do local contractors handle wood window installation projects? Local service providers typically assess the existing structure, select appropriate wood materials, and ensure proper fitting and sealing for durability and performance.
What should be considered when selecting wood windows for my home? Factors include the style of the window, type of wood, energy efficiency features, and compatibility with the home's architecture and existing window openings.
Are there specific maintenance requirements for wood windows after installation? Yes, wood windows generally require regular painting or sealing to protect against moisture and weathering, helping to maintain their appearance and functionality.
